Here's a Cactus Wren perched on - well - whatcha expect!? The image was taken in the last light of the evening just before sunset. My mind still isn't made up on colour temperature - too warm?

Canon 5DII -- Canon 800mm f/5.6L IS -- 1/500s @ f/6.3 -- ISO640 -- 0 EV -- Fill Flash @ -2 2/3EV
